阻止报价边框/填充/颜色问题

时间:2015-10-17 17:34:07

标签: html css

我正在使用bootstrap创建一个个人页面,并且想要使用blockquote元素,但是在左侧我得到一条白线,即使我将元素包装在多个div中并尝试覆盖任何内容也不会消失边界或边距问题阻止它具有相同的背景颜色。有人可以帮我弄清楚该做什么吗?

HTML

<div class="top-info">  
            <div class="row">
                <div class="col-md-4"><img src="http://www.psdgraphics.com/file/male-silhouette.jpg" width="300" height="250" ></div>
                <div class="col-md-8">

                <blockquote>    
                        <p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la gravida velit sit amet dolor iaculis, nec semper felis dictum. Vestibulum commodo magna sed enim elementum, in euismod purus molestie. Nulla et nisl sit amet ipsum eleifend facilisis et a nisi. Cras lectus arcu, efficitur ac dictum vel, porttitor lobortis purus. Phasellus tincidunt velit eget ipsum aliquam, non egestas tellus consequat. Curabitur ullamcorper, massa et consequat mollis, metus neque rhoncus felis, eget condimentum lacus elit ac lacus. Pellentesque volutpat euismod neque, nec semper nisl interdum ac. </p>
                    </blockquote>

                </div>
            </div>
        </div>

CSS:

.top-info{
    background-color:#848484;
    margin:0;
    padding:0;
}
blockquote{
    background-color:#848484;
    padding:none;
    margin:none;
} 

2 个答案:

答案 0 :(得分:0)

默认情况下,

Bootstrap使用border-left元素中的blockquote。设置为none将删除边框。

<强> CSS

blockquote {
    border-left: none;
}

答案 1 :(得分:0)

Bootstrap使用border-left属性设置此&#34;白线&#34;在左边。因此,您需要做的就是使用自定义CSS样式重置它,例如:

blockquote {
    border-left: 0;
}